Thrive Themes (Benefits And Drawbacks)
Thrive Themes is one of the most sophisticated, yet user friendly suite of site building tools.
Thrive Themes provides WordPress themes and plugins, as well as a no-code drag-and-drop editor that permits you to develop unique websites even with no technical abilities.
This conversion-focused set of tools is created with one objective, and that is to assist you turn site visitors into subscribing customers.
With it, you will have the ability to get more traffic, more leads, more subscribers, and more clients for your service.
As with any tool (however remarkable), there are pros and cons you need to consider prior to choosing whether or not it’s best for your site.
Pros:
- Conversion Focus: There are very couple of suppliers on the market who have such a huge portfolio of tools concentrated on marketing, optimization, and lead generation.
- Numerous Page Templates: You can pick from nearly 300 templates to assist you begin developing websites rapidly. Thrive Themes Pros Cons List.
- Free Training: They’ve developed Thrive University, which has lots of courses where you can find out everything you require to learn about how to utilize each of the tools.
- Easy to Use: Thrive Themes has an extremely user-friendly interface. The drag and drop editor makes it easy to produce pages– even for newbies.
- Great 3rd-Party Integrations: You can easily integrate with tons of other marketing tools and services, such as plugins, platforms, and so on
- Fully Responsive: The Thrive Themes page contractor and design templates are all 100% responsive.
- Perfect for WordPress: The WordPress themes and plugins work perfectly for WordPress websites and are enhanced for the WordPress platform.
Cons:
- A Great Deal of Products: The large variety of tools used by Thrive Themes can prove overwhelming for beginners.
- Knowing Curve: Similar to any new platform out there, Thrive Themes suite of products all have their own knowing curve. I do believe the platforms are user-friendly, but it takes some time and patience to master them.
- Just Works With WordPress: There’s no variation of Thrive Themes that works with Drupal, Joomla, or any other site platform.
- Support Action Time: It’s not that the support for Thrive Themes is bad, it’s really quite good. Sometimes it takes hours to get a reaction which is irritating when you’re in the middle of doing something.

Thrive Leads
Thrive Leads is a tool that you can use to construct your e-mail lists. Whatever that you might require to bring in and inspire readers to register for your e-mail list is consisted of, that makes it such an effective tool.
You can display the forms using the various choices. You can select a pop-up opt-in kind or include it in your sidebar widget and only have these trigger on mobile, or on desktop. There are a lots of various display alternatives for Thrive Leads.
Furthermore, it enables you to measure efficiency and conduct split tests. You get reports that supply you with deep insights on how your e-mail marketing technique is working so you understand how to improve it.
This is a BIG offer due to the fact that you can check various test or visuals to see what will convert much better and supply you with more e-mail subscribers.

Thrive Themes vs. Divi
One of Thrive Themes main rivals is Classy . These 2 companies come from comparable backgrounds, and both began as Themes contractors however later branched out into custom plugins and other more intricate tools that serve a larger variety of needs.
As one of the Thrive Themes’ main competitors, Sophisticated provides 2 main options that most directly challenge Thrive tools, and these are Divi, their page contractor, and Flower, their opt-in type plugin.
The Divi Home Builder by Classy Themes is a professionally crafted page home builder that features premium functions. While the Divi contractor masters a lot of locations and provides a lot of intriguing features, it’s not as easy to utilize as Thrive Architect in my viewpoint.
Similar to Thrive Designer, it can also be integrated into your WordPress website to assist you create pages of your own design. Both these tools have functions that are comparable, which makes it challenging to declare the best between them.
Their opt-in kind plugin, Flower does a lot of what Thrive Leads does however when it pertains to versatility and modification choices, Thrive Leads is more robust.
Like Thrive Themes, Elegant Themes provides a yearly subscription for just $89/year compared to Thrive’s $228/year subscription. Unlike Thrive, you don’t get quiz builder, course builder, A/B screening tools, etc. with your membership.
